"Doing Too Much" is the debut single released by American singer Paula DeAnda. It features Baby Bash. It reached number forty-one on the US Billboard Hot 100. The song also peaked at number nine on the Billboard Rhythmic chart.[1] A Spanish version of the song was also released titled "Lo que hago por tu amor" ("What I Do for Your Love").
